Little Mix have been named 2015 MTV EMAs Best UK and Ireland Act.

The four-piece girl band - featuring Perrie Edwards, Jade Thirlwall, Leigh-Anne Pinnock and Jesy Nelson - have fought off competition from Ellie Goulding, Sam Smith, Tinie Tempah, Calvin Harris and James Bay to win the title, ahead of the MTV EMAs on Sunday October 25.

The 'Black Magic' hitmakers - who will release their third studio album 'Get Weird' next month - received the most votes in the public poll and will now go up against acts from across Europe to compete for the Best Worldwide Act: Europe award, which fans can vote for through the event's website until October 24.

This year's ceremony is being held in the Mediolanum Forum in Milan, Italy, and will be hosted by Ed Sheeran and 'Orange is the New Black' star Ruby Rose.

Pharrell Williams will open the show, while other performers include Ed and Rudimental, Ellie Goulding, Jason Derulo, Tori Kelly, Jess Glynne and Macklemore & Ryan Lewis.

Taylor Swift leads the nominations for the event, being up for nine awards including Best Female and Best Pop, while Justin Bieber has been shortlisted for six prizes.
